CI Troubleshooting: Websocket Compression on Brindlecast

Enabling permessage-deflate on the Brindlecast gateway cuts bandwidth roughly 60% but raises p99 latency under load, and the CI soak test flags this as a regression. If the soak stage fails only on compressed runs, compare memory ceilings before blocking the release. For verification against the staging gateway, use the build token noted below.

pipeline stamp: htk14_378fd70323001d

## Deployment

The Brindlekit shared component library follows strict semantic versioning; a new major version is published only after the deprecation window documented in the upgrade notes. Deployments to the Fernwald registry are automated on tagged releases, and each consumer pins an exact version. Before your first deploy, confirm the pipeline reads the configuration values below.

settings of bawif-fawif:
ralix:
  log_level: warn
  metrics_host: metrics.ralix.tolvaqsys.internal
  pool_size: 32

Welcome to the Fillwise plugin program! Fillwise plans restock routes for vending fleets, and your plugin can hook into the demand forecaster or the route optimizer. Grab the SDK, run the sample plugin, and poke around the mock fleet data. To test against a realistic dataset, spin up the sandbox database and connect with the string below.

primary connection of yagep-kahip = redis://giliel_svc:zYiKsLL2PLpfPL@db-348f.xolmarsys.corp:5432/fenwyn

- [ ] **Step 7: Breaker override escrow.** After sealing the signing keys for the Tallgrove upstream API circuit breaker, confirm the support team can force the breaker open during a full outage. The override bundle lives in the sealed escrow drawer and is useless without its unlock phrase. Two ceremony witnesses must initial this step before proceeding. The escrow bundle is decrypted with the recovery passphrase that follows.

vault phrase of kahip-kahop = holath-quenmir

Leadership Review Briefing — Loyalty Overhaul

Heads of department: the Quillhaven loyalty scheme is underperforming. Redemption costs up, engagement flat. Proposal: collapse five tiers to three, cut breakage-dependent perks, add partner offers via Norfell Retail. Decision required at the leadership review; implementation within two quarters. Costings attached separately. The underlying commercial intent is stated in the confidential note below.

management briefing: Project Ulavan slips by two quarters because of the staffing delay.